New Horizons Medical is committed to assisting the people of Quincy, Massachusetts and the surrounding areas to find full recovery after a period of struggling with drug and alcohol addiction. New Horizons Medical offers a wide range of services in line with their philosophy of treatments that work - including Outpatient Programs, Outpatient Methadone/Buprenorphine or Vivitrol and others.

New Horizons Medical also believes that it is crucial that every individual client gets highly personalized services to ensure their recovery. This is why it is specialized in a wide variety of treatment modalities, including Cognitive/behavior Therapy, Dialectical Behavior Therapy, Anger management and others. In addition, New Horizons Medical is specialized in Persons With Co-Occurring Mental And Substance Abuse Disorders,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Or Transgender (LGBT) Clients, Veterans, as well as other special programs. In general, the treatment services that this alcohol and drug rehab uses strive to achieve true and lasting sobriety for each of its clients.

Lastly, New Horizons Medical accepts Cash or Self-Payment, Medicaid and more.
